Transaction 7718393d14d83cd76e342b030d2cf0b3d5421f5bc73d9acf1f8968c5d4db1e51
1 Input
1 Output
-
7718393d14d83cd76e342b030d2cf0b3d5421f5bc73d9acf1f8968c5d4db1e51:0
- value
- 1871752
- script pubkey
- OP_0 OP_PUSHBYTES_20 3dd720530a4102b297d72bf08f9644adb1badf15
- address
- bc1q8htjq5c2gypt997h90cgl9jy4kcm4hc4aq2s3z